			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Several months ago, I wrote a post about TruthCasting.com and their streaming service for churches.  Several readers started using this great service.  The only inhibitor for some was the new equipment purchase of a Mac Mini for the cost of $700.00.   In reality, $700.00 for a one-time setup was extremely inexpensive compared to the monthly fees of other services.  Included in the signup was unlimited and archived streaming of sermon video and audio.   Now, the TC techs have put their heads together to get your message out on the web with no cost to you.</p>
<p>Let me give a quick refresher.  Basically how TC works is as follows:</p>
<ol>
<li>Record your sermon (no singing) on a DVD.</li>
<li>Insert the DVD into your &#8220;TruthCasting Media Slingshot&#8221; AKA &#8220;Your Computer&#8221;</li>
<li>Their awesome software rips the video and the audio and then uploads it to the TC servers.</li>
<li>Within a couple of hours, your sermon is ready to view on your internet channel!</li>
</ol>
<p>Once you&#8217;ve completed your upload, you can embed your sermon on your website.  You don&#8217;t have to purchase a new Mac Mini  all you need are the following system requirements for the free download.</p>
<ul>
<li><em>Mac OSX 10.5 &#8211; Intel or PPC</em></li>
<li><em></em>Windows XP/Vista &#8211; Pentium 4 2.4 Ghz or Athlon XP 2500+</li>
<li>512 MB of RAM (1 GB recommended)</li>
<li><em>40 MB for Application and 6 GB for video transfer</em></li>
</ul>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>If you record your services on CD chances are the audio is broken up into tracks.  For those who don&#8217;t record digitally, this is a problem when trying to create a podcast. Now you can take all of those annoying little tracks and combine them into one with Merge MP3.  <a href="http://www.komkon.org/~shchuka/software/mergemp3/" target="_blank">Grab it here.</a> (via <a href="http://www.lifehacker.com" target="_blank">Lifehacker</a>) </p>
